
Sun Bum
Sun Bum is a consumer goods company that makes sunscreen, hair care, lip care, and after-sun products. Founded in 2010 and acquired by SC Johnson in 2019, the brand is known for its beach lifestyle positioning and vitamin-infused formulations.
The Story
Sun Bum started in 2010 when a group of beach-loving friends in Cocoa Beach, Florida, decided the sunscreen aisle needed a brand that matched their lifestyle.
What began as a simple mission to protect friends and family from the sun quickly turned into a cultural phenomenon, thanks to a distinctive gorilla logo, wood-grain packaging, and formulas packed with vitamin E.
The brand grew from a local startup into a national presence, moving its headquarters to Encinitas, California, and expanding into hair care, lip care, and after-sun products.
In 2019, SC Johnson acquired Sun Bum for $400 million, validating the power of a brand built on beach culture and clean ingredients. Today, Sun Bum remains committed to its original ethos: trust the bum, and keep the good times rolling.

Company Timeline
2010 — Founded Sun Bum in Cocoa Beach, Florida
Started making sunscreen products for friends and family, creating the iconic gorilla logo and wood-grain packaging.
2014 — Expanded into hair care and lip care
Moved headquarters to Encinitas, California, and introduced hair care and lip care products beyond sun protection.
2019 — Acquired by SC Johnson for $400 million
SC Johnson acquired Sun Bum, bringing the beach lifestyle brand into its portfolio of trusted consumer goods.
